Partage via


JsonSerializerOptions.MaxDepth Propriété

Définition

Obtient ou définit la profondeur maximale autorisée lors de la sérialisation ou de la désérialisation de code JSON, avec la valeur par défaut de 0 indiquant une profondeur maximale de 64.

public:
 property int MaxDepth { int get(); void set(int value); };
public int MaxDepth { get; set; }
member this.MaxDepth : int with get, set
Public Property MaxDepth As Integer

Valeur de propriété

Int32

Profondeur maximale autorisée lors de la sérialisation ou de la désérialisation JSON.

Exceptions

Cette propriété a été définie après la sérialisation ou la désérialisation.

La profondeur maximale est définie avec une valeur négative.

Remarques

Aller au-delà de cette profondeur lève un JsonException.

S’applique à